Bird Watching with DEC Educator and Bird Enthusiast, Kathy Kirsch Bird Watching with DEC Educator and Bird Enthusiast, Kathy Kirsch KristenMeyer / Wednesday, May 7, 2025 0 1790 Clark Meadows residents were out on a bird walk with Dawne Gould's daughter, Kathy Kirsch. Kathy is an expert bird watcher who can identify the bird calls, bird sightings and bird behaviors as well as plant species. We enjoyed our natural surroundings with our own conservation expert. She'll be back on May 19th for another bird walk. Thank you Kathy! Read more

Dorothy Lander Shares Letters and Pictures from Floridian First Graders! Dorothy Lander Shares Letters and Pictures from Floridian First Graders! Sharing Finger Lakes Foliage with Young Floridians turns into a Treasure of Letters and Drawings! KristenMeyer / Thursday, March 27, 2025 0 2712 Last Fall, Dorothy (Dot) Lander collected a box of colorful leaves and sent them to her daughter, Janet, who is a 1st grade teacher in Florida. Janet's students, many of whom had never been exposed to the beautiful Fingerlakes colors, responded in a most thoughtful way. They drew pictures and composed letters. Dot was so surprised and overcome with joy when she opened the package. These pictures and letters have been displayed in the CM living room this week for all CM residents, staff, families and visitors to enjoy! A big thank you to Dot for sharing with all of us. We have been in awe of the thoughful messages, the drawings, and the amazing penmanship coming from such young children. Read more
Lynne Standish / Wednesday, May 11, 2022 / Categories: Ferris Hills Blog, Clark Meadows Blog Recognizing our Shining Star! Each year, Thompson Health has a "Shining Star" ceremony for those associates who have been nominated by their peers for exceptional work and abiding by the CARES values. Winners are chosen by a secret committee. A number of staff were on hand Tuesday, May 10th for this ceremony. One of our Nutrition associates, Laura Hillson was surprised and pleased to be honored with her shining star this year! "As the lead server and host in the Clark Meadows dining room, Laura is often the first person residents see in the morning, and she never fails to bring sunshine to their day. She takes the time to ask how they're doing, commits their likes and dislikes to memory, listens intently to their needs and promptly follows up if one has a special order or concern. She takes pride in training new associates and is a role model to all with her energy, her patience and her take-charge, effervescent personality. As one associate said, "CARES values?
